QUESTIONNAIRE

RIGHT TO LIFE

Human life deserves legal protection from conception until natural death.

Strongly Agree

I believe every human life has value and deserves protection. I am pro-life and support protecting unborn children while also supporting mothers, families, adoption, and access to resources that help both mother and child. I also believe we should respect and protect human dignity throughout every stage of life.

The lives of human embryos created through artificial methods ought to be protected from purposeful destruction.

Agree

I believe human life is valuable and should be treated with dignity and respect at every stage of development, including embryos created through artificial methods. Scientific advancement is important, but it should be guided by strong ethical standards and respect for human life.

Under what circumstances should an elective abortion be allowed?

I am pro-life and believe unborn life should be protected. However, I support limited exceptions in cases of rape, incest, danger to the life of the mother, and severe or life-debilitating fetal abnormalities. These are deeply personal and difficult situations, and they should be approached with compassion, medical guidance, and respect for both life and the well-being of the mother and family.

ECONOMY

Free enterprise and the right to private property are essential elements of a productive economic system.

Strongly Agree

Free enterprise and private property rights are foundational to both economic opportunity and individual freedom. Small businesses, ranchers, entrepreneurs, and working families deserve the ability to build, invest, and grow without excessive government interference. I’ve spent my life building businesses and creating jobs, so I understand firsthand that when people are free to work hard, take risks, and keep what they earn, communities prosper.

People who can afford to pay more taxes should do so in order to provide relief for working families.

Disagree

I believe the tax system should be fair, simple, and encourage growth, not punish success. Working Americans and small business owners are already carrying too much of the burden while the tax code remains overly complicated and full of loopholes. I would support moving toward a flat tax system where every American pays the same rate.

The government should cut spending in order to reduce the national debt.

Strongly Agree

Washington doesn’t have a revenue problem — it has a spending problem. Families and businesses across Oklahoma have to live within a budget, and the federal government should do the same. We need fiscal responsibility, less wasteful spending, and leadership willing to make tough decisions to protect future generations.

NATIONAL SECURITY

With regard to America's foreign policy, which view most closely resembles yours: A) The United States should intervene whenever freedom is threatened. B) The United States should selectively help countries trying to grow democracy and fight tyranny. C) The United States has become too involved in others' policies and should remain focused on issues regarding our own sovereignty unless in imminent danger. D) The United States should stay out of foreign conflicts completely.

C, but every situation is different. The United States cannot involve itself in every conflict. At the same time, we cannot simply stand by and allow hostile governments or dangerous actors to overrun peaceful nations unchecked. Bad actors in the world do need to be confronted. However, before sending America’s sons and daughters into harm’s way, our leaders must carefully assess the mission, the risks, the long-term outcome, and whether it truly serves America’s national interests.

The Chinese Communist Party poses serious military, cyber security, intellectual property, and global economic threats to the United States.

Strongly Agree

The Chinese Communist Party poses one of the greatest long-term threats to the United States — economically, militarily, technologically, and through cyber warfare and intellectual property theft. I also believe we need stronger oversight of foreign land ownership, particularly near critical infrastructure, military sites and farm land.Americans must take this threat seriously and strengthen our national security, supply chains, energy independence, minerals, we must secure our power and water.

Is the United States' relationship with Israel important, and if so why?

Yes. Israel is one of the United States’ strongest and most important allies in the Middle East. Our relationship is important because Israel shares many of our democratic values, has been a reliable strategic partner, and plays a critical role in regional stability and national security. The United States should continue to support strong alliances that help protect our interests, combat terrorism, and promote peace through strength.

EDUCATION

I support eliminating the U.S. Department of Education and giving control back to states and communities.

Agree

The U.S. performed much stronger internationally in the mid-20th century. Americans educated in the 1960s ranked around 3rd internationally in literacy comparisons. Americans educated in the 1970s ranked around 5th. Now we rank 34th. The United States already spends more money on education than almost any country in the world, yet our student performance continues to decline in many key areas especially math. The problem is not simply funding; it’s bureaucracy, lack of accountability.

ELECTIONS AND VOTING

People should be able to vote without photo identification.

Strongly Disagree

Free and fair elections are the foundation of our republic, and requiring photo identification to vote is simply common sense. Americans are required to show ID to board a plane, open a bank account, go to a doctor, buy a firearm, purchase tobacco, rent a hotel room, and for countless other everyday activities. Choosing the leaders of our communities and our country should carry at least the same level of verification.
